Transaction 9183a8a362a2fc790b85c16bfddbda4c8bdb97f7977986743debceae5fefdfb3

6 Input
2 Outputs
  • 9183a8a362a2fc790b85c16bfddbda4c8bdb97f7977986743debceae5fefdfb3:0
  • value  25664057
    address  1FHrU3x44kQPWkvdPRZ9Dy9dJnoiTGbJxC
  • 9183a8a362a2fc790b85c16bfddbda4c8bdb97f7977986743debceae5fefdfb3:1
  • value  484597
    address  17K1MQbpxtDUjY4V4Eu8XN51ZNcNGkYadZ